- Too Smart TessReceived repeated calls with no caller id info. Left messages saying he was a process server for a civil litigation matter. Male caller left no name nor company name as to who was filing complaint. He cited an address of mine which was sold more than 18 years ago and was not sure who in the household he was trying to reach. A week later called again this time giving a number to call him back and a case # to reference so that an agreement could be reached to handle "complaint" out of court. It is a scam. Do not panic nor give out any personal information. They are looking for easy targets to make a quick buck. The number is registered to a mobile series based out of India.

- Creepy callerMy wife and I received three phone calls from this number on our private cell phones. A man sounded like he was reading a script and kept stating that "unless he received a prompt call the papers would be issued to the address on file as valid". Whatever that means. It came across sounding like someone with no legal background was trying to sound like a lawyer.
However, he made calls on different days to our numbers stating the same thing. Ended each message with, "and good luck to you." obviously some sort of scam but the message is unsettling. When calling the number he left on the message a woman answered "corporate office". When we asked what kind of corporate office is this, the woman said "a law office" and "everyones gone", this was at 5:15pm, she repeatedly asked me for my case number, which i did not give. All very strange and unsettling. This should be reported to someone like a news agency. I can easily see how someone would get taken advantage of.- Caller: BMG
